您的位置:首页 > 大数据 > 云计算

Linux云计算架构师成长之路-第二章 Linux系统及特性-2.2 什么是Linux?

2019-03-02 16:06 274 查看

2.2 什么是Linux?

    Linux和我们熟识的Windows一样也是一个操作系统,但和Windows不同的是Linux是一套开放源代码程序的、并且可以自由传播的类Unix操作系统软件(Unix系统是Linux系统的前身,具备很多优秀特性)。其在设计之初,就是基于Intel x86系列CPU架构计算机的。它是一个基于POSIX1的多用户、多任务并且支持多线程和多CPU的操作系统。

Linux是由世界各地成千上万的程序员设计和开发实现的。当初开发Linux的目的就是建立在不受商业化软件版权制约的、全世界都能自由使用的类Unix操作系统兼容产品,在过去的30年里,Linux系统主要被应用于服务器端、嵌入式开发和个人桌面系统3个应用领域。

服务器端的应用:国内前500网站几乎全是Linux,全球估计前10000的网站(除了微软)有99%都是Linux,我们熟知的大型、超大型互联网企业(百度,新浪,谷歌,Facebook,淘宝等)都使用Linux作为其服务器端的程序运行平台,全球及国内排名前十的网站使用的主流系统几乎都是Linux系统。

Linux之所以流行,是因为有以下特点:

l  是开放源代码的程序软件,可以自由修改,

l  与Unix系统兼容,具备几乎所有Unix的优秀特性。

l  适合Intel等X86架构的计算机。

 

名词解析:

POSIX全称为Portable Operating System Interface,中文翻译为可移植操作系统接口,POSIX标准定义了操作系统应该为应用程序提供的接口标准。

内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: 
相关文章推荐